August 08, 2011Episode 15: Supreme Court GamingWe follow up from our discussion in Episode 3, in which I and the panel discussed the video game case brought before the Supreme Court--specifically, to determine the constitutionality of California's 2005 law that would make it a crime to sell violent video games to minors. Now, the Court has rendered its decision, and we discuss what the ruling will have on the video game industry.
